The Library has launched a new program called Tech for All. Through this program, qualified applicants will receive free refurbished Windows-based laptops and mobile Wi-Fi hotspots. Applications are now closed. Selected participants will be chosen through a randomized selection process and notified by April 3. Information about future application windows will be shared as it becomes available. Questions? Contact the Library’s Digital Equity team by email at CPLDigitalEquity@cambridgema.gov.

How can I get in touch with a digital navigator?
To book an appointment with the Cambridge Public Library Digital Navigator you can call 888.551.2167 or send an email to GetHelp@MassDigitalJEDI.org.
How do I register to attend a one-on-one tech help session?
You can register to attend tech help sessions through our tech help calendar or, by calling the branch where you would like to attend a class. View the upcoming one-on-one tech help sessions to register.
Do I need an appointment for one-on-one tech help or tech classes?
Registration for tech classes and tech help sessions is not required unless otherwise stated.
